Purpose and content of the course

Course Objectives: The aim is to examine the impact of nutrition on health, focusing on macro nutrients (carbohydrates, proteins, fats) and micro nutrients (vitamins and minerals), to assess their requirements and effects on metabolism across different age groups.

This assessment involves identifying the nutritional needs of different age groups to understand the essential nutrients required for maintaining a healthy life and examining their effects on metabolic processes.
Course Objective: Understanding the Relationship Between Nutrition and Health
Comprehending the overall effects of nutrition on general health.
Identifying the essential nutrients necessary for a healthy life.
Evaluating Macro Nutrients (Examining the functions and requirements of carbohydrates, proteins, and fats in the body.)
Evaluating Micro Nutrients (Studying the functions and requirements of vitamins and minerals.)
Investigating the Effects of Nutrition and Food Choices on Metabolism
Recognizing the need to tailor nutritional plans to individuals' age, gender, health status, and lifestyle.
Identifying Health Problems Caused by Inadequate or Imbalanced Nutrition
These objectives aim to provide students with in-depth knowledge of nutrition science and its applications.

Course Topics

Week Subject
Related Preparation Pekiştirme
1) Basic Principles of Nutrition:
2) Adequate and Balanced Nutrition for Health
3) Carbohydrates
4) Proteins
5) Fat
6) Energy Metabolism, Water
7) Sınav
8) Fat soluble vitamines (Vitamin A, Vitamin D)
9) Fat soluble vitamins (Vitamin E, Vitamin K)
10) Vitamin B
11) Vitamin B, Vitamin C
12) Minerals I
13) Minerals II
14) Nutrition for special populations
15) Exam
15) General review
16) Exam
